  • This paper describes a moving mesh technique for dynamic characteristics analysis of permanent magnet linear synchronous motor with the secondary aluminium sheet. The moving mesh technique applied to the linear induction motor can be used to analyze the linear synchronous motor with the rectangular permanent magnet. But in case of the permanent magnet with taper, the shape of the permanent magnet is presented. The time-stepped finite element method is used for the dynamic characteristics simulation of the permanent magnet linear synchronous motor, The results of application example(hysteresis current controlled inverter fed control) such as thrust, current and flux plots are shown.

  • An unstructured mesh method has been developed for the simulation of steady and time-accurate flows around helicopter rotors. A dynamic and quasi-unsteady solution-adaptive mesh refinement technique was adopted for the enhancement of the solution accuracy in the local region of interest involving highly vortical flows. Applications were made to the 2-D blade-vortex interaction aerodynamics and the 3-D rotor blades in hover. The interaction between the rotor and the airframe in forward flight was investigated by introducing an overset mesh technique.

  • A high-order accurate Euler flow solver based on a discontinuous Galerkin method has been developed for the numerical simulation of unsteady flows on unstructured meshes. A multi-level solution-adaptive mesh refinement/coarsening technique was adopted to enhance the resolution of numerical solutions efficiently by increasing mesh density in the high-gradient region. An acoustic wave scattering problem was investigated to assess the accuracy of the present discontinuous Galerkin solver, and a supersonic flow in a wind tunnel with a forward facing step was simulated by using the adaptive mesh refinement technique. It was shown that the present discontinuous Galerkin flow solver can capture unsteady flows including the propagation and scattering of the acoustic waves as well as the strong shock waves.

  • The view dependency of typical spatial-partitioning based NC simulation methods is overcome by polygon rendering technique that generates polygons to represent the workpiece, thus enabling dynamic viewing transformations without reconstruction of the entire data structure. However, the polygon rendering technique still has difficulty in realizing real-time simulation due to unsatisfactory performance of current graphics devices. Therefore, it is necessary to develop a mesh decimation method that enables rapid rendering without loss of display quality. In this paper. we proposed a new mesh decimation algorithm thor a workpiece whose shape varies dynamically. In this algorithm, the 2-map data thor a given workpiece is divided into several regions, and a triangular mesh is constructed for each region first. Then, if any region it cut by the tool, its mesh is regenerated and decimated again. Since the range of mesh decimation is confined to a few regions, the reduced polygons for rendering can be obtained rapidly. Our method enables the polygon-rendering based NC simulation to be applied to the computers equipped with a wider range of graphics cards.

  • A high-order accurate Euler flow solver based on a discontinuous Galerkin finite-element method has been developed for the numerical simulations of blade-vortex interaction phenomena on unstructured meshes. A free vortex in freestream was investigated to assess the vortex-preserving property and the accuracy of the present flow solver. Blade-vortex interaction problems in subsonic and transonic freestreams were simulated by adopting a multi-level solution-adaptive dynamic mesh refinement/coarsening technique. The results were compared with those of other numerical and experimental methods. It was shown that the present discontinuous Galerkin flow solver can preserve the vortex structure for significantly longer vortex convection time and can accurately capture the complex unsteady blade-vortex interaction flows, including generation and propagation of acoustic waves.

  • 스텔스 성능을 향상시키기 위해 꼬리날개를 제거한 무미익 항공기는 러더(rudder)를 대체하여 스포일러(spoiler)를 활용하여 방향조종을 수행한다. 짧은 시간에 스포일러 작동을 반복하는 경우 비정상적(unsteady)이고 비선형적인 공력특성이 발생하여 항공기 비행성능에 역효과(adverse effect)를 초래할 수 있다. 본 연구에서는 dynamic mesh 기법을 적용한 전산해석을 통하여 스포일러 전개에 따른 에어포일의 비정상 공력 특성을 해석하였다. 스포일러 전개 속도, 장착 위치, 전개 스케줄(deployment scheduling) 변화에 따른 공력특성을 분석하여 스포일러의 동적 작동에 따른 역효과를 감소시킬 수 있는 방안을 검토하였다. 스포일러 장착위치 및 전개 방식의 적절한 선정을 통해 스포일러 동적 역효과를 감소시킬 수 있음을 확인하였으며, 에어포일 형상최적화를 통한 역효과 감소방안에 대한 추가적인 연구가 필요한 것으로 판단된다. 이러한 동적 공력 데이터는 향후 무미익 형태의 항공기 개발에 기초자료로 활용될 수 있을 것이다.

  • 기동 성능과 스텔스 성능을 극대화시키기 위해 무미익 람다(lambda) 형상의 무인전투기에 대한 연구개발이 각 국에서 활발히 진행되고 있다. 이러한 형상의 비행체는 불안정한 동적 비행특성을 가질 가능성이 높으며, 이를 비행제어 시스템으로 제어하기 위해서는 보다 정확한 동안정 미계수 예측이 필수적이다. 본 연구에서는 풍동기법의 단점을 보완하고 순수 공기역학적 동안정 미계수를 예측하기 위해 전산유체역학의 Dynamic Mesh 기법을 적용하여 강제진동법을 모사하였고, 해석결과를 기존에 확보한 시험결과와 비교하여 검증하였다. 해석결과는 종축 동안정 미계수에 국한하였으며, 무미익 람다 형상의 기준 받음 각, 진동주파수, 진동폭 등의 변화에 따른 동안정 미계수 변화 경향성을 파악하였다. 전산해석 결과는 풍동시험 데이터와 유사한 경향성을 보였으며, 제시된 연구기법을 통해 항공기 동안정 미계수를 효율적으로 구할 수 있음을 확인하였다.

  • Urban flood simulation plays a vital role in national flood early warning, prevention and mitigation. In recent studies on 2-dimensional flood modeling, the integrated run-off inundation model is gaining grounds due to its ability to perform in greater computational efficiency. The adaptive quadtree shallow water numerical technique used in this model implements the adaptive mesh refinement (AMR) in this simulation, a procedure in which the grid resolution is refined automatically following the flood flow. The method discounts the necessity to create a whole domain mesh over a complex catchment area, which is one of the most time-consuming steps in flood simulation. This research applies the dynamic grid refinement method in simulating the recent extreme flood events in Metro Manila, Philippines. The rainfall events utilized were during Typhoon Ketsana 2009, and Southwest monsoon surges in 2012 and 2013. In order to much more visualize the urban flooding that incorporates the flow within buildings and high-elevation areas, Digital Surface Model (DSM) resolution of 5m was used in representing the ground elevation. Results were calibrated through the flood point validation data and compared to the present flood hazard maps used for policy making by the national government agency. The accuracy and efficiency of the method provides a strong front in making it commendable to use for early warning and flood inundation analysis for future similar flood events.
